Shotcrete (also recognised because of the trade identify Gunite) uses compressed air to shoot concrete on to (or into) a frame or composition. The greatest benefit of the process is always that shotcrete can be used overhead or on vertical surfaces without formwork. It is usually used for concrete repairs or placement on bridges, dams, pools, and on other purposes exactly where forming is costly or material handling and set up is difficult.

Concrete demands about 28 days of curing time. It's important that during the very first seven days Once you pour it you wet the concrete floor day-to-day. This will permit the curing process to go smoothly and properly given that the cement reaches its highest strength likely.

GFRC is combined using a mortar mixer or a paddle mixer, as an alternative to a traditional concrete mixer. Little batches under 30 lbs. can still be blended by hand.

Cement also has silicon, aluminum, iron, and several different other secondary ingredients. Cement may be the bonding agent that holds the aggregate and sand of concrete with each other once it cures.

Self-loading concrete mixers are fitted to building sites exactly where concrete batching plants are unavailable, underfoot disorders are not suited to concrete transit mixer trucks or labor availability is scarce or constrained.
